The size of Scullin is approximately 1.4 square kilometres. It has 13 parks covering nearly 8.4% of total area. The population of Scullin in 2016 was 2929 people. By 2021 the population was 3069 showing a population growth of 4.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Scullin is 30-39 years. Households in Scullin are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Scullin work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 66.80% of the homes in Scullin were owner-occupied compared with 62.70% in 2016.
